Average 4.97kWh/day in Autumn. Average 5.97kWh/day in Winter. Average 5.97kWh/day in Spring. To maximize your solar PV system's energy output in Panama City, Panama (Lat/Long 8.9658, -79.5321) throughout the year, you should tilt your panels at an angle of 9° South for fixed panel installations.
Photovoltaic cost data between 1975 and 2003 has been taken from Nemet (2009), between 2004 and 2009 from Farmer & Lafond (2016), and since 2010 from IRENA. Prices from Nemet (2009) and Farmer & Lafond (2016) have been converted to 2024 US$ using the US GDP deflator, to account for the effects of inflation.
NREL analyzes the total costs associated with installing photovoltaic (PV) systems for residential rooftop, commercial rooftop, and utility-scale ground-mount systems. This work has grown to include cost models for solar-plus-storage systems. NREL's PV cost benchmarking work uses a bottom-up approach.
